Community Hot Water Statistics - Mount Binga, 4306
Hot Water Demographics - Mount Binga
Based on the Australian Bureau of Statistics 2021 Census (ABS), Mount Binga has around 15,097 private dwellings, home to approximately 40,828 people. With an average household size of 2.9 people, and around 50 litres of hot water used per person each day in Australia, Mount Binga households use approximately 145 litres of hot water daily, equating to a massive 2.2 million litres of hot water used across the suburb every single day.
Other census insights reinforce Mount Binga's suitability for energy-saving improvements like energy-efficient or solar-powered hot water. The Mount Binga community is home to 4,295 couple families with children and 983 one-parent families, meaning a large proportion of households face substantial hot water demand. With 7,145 homes owned with a mortgage and 3,548 owned outright, many residents also have the homeownership and growing equity that make switching to efficient hot water systems a practical way to lower expenses.
Mount Binga is converting hot water demand to efficient systems faster than many peers, with 18.1% of dwellings already upgraded.

In terms of savings, many Mount Binga households are weighing up heat pump vs solar hot water, or solar hot water vs electric hot water, based on roof space, budget and whether they already have solar PV. Typical annual bill savings can look like this:
• Replacing an old electric hot water system with a heat pump hot water system: about $350–$700 per year. • Switching from gas hot water to a heat pump hot water system: about $250–$600 per year. • Switching from gas to a solar hot water system: about $300–$650 per year. • Replacing a tired electric system with a modern electric hot water installation powered by solar PV: about $250–$500 per year.
These ranges will vary with usage and tariffs, but they give a realistic sense of what a well‑chosen energy efficient hot water system can do for a typical 4306 family home.

Hot Water Rebates, Tariffs & Savings
For Mount Binga homeowners and businesses, the economics of upgrading are helped along by a mix of federal and state incentives. Eligible solar hot water systems and heat pump hot water systems can generate Small‑scale Technology Certificates (STCs), which act like an upfront discount off the solar hot water price / cost or heat pump hot water price / cost. On top of that, Queensland programs can offer a heat pump hot water rebate or solar hot water rebate from time to time, and there are also schemes that effectively work as an electric hot water system rebate when you replace an old, inefficient unit with a qualifying energy efficient hot water system. For many 4306 homes, these hot water rebate qld incentives can reduce the hot water system price / cost by a substantial percentage, and typical savings of a few hundred dollars per year on bills mean payback periods can be cut right down, especially if you use timers or solar diversion to run the system when your solar is generating.
